A118964 Triangle read by rows: T(n,k) is the number of Grand Dyck paths of semilength n that have k double rises above the x-axis (n>=1,k>=0). (A Grand Dyck path of semilength n is a path in the half-plane x>=0, starting at (0,0), ending at (2n,0) and consisting of steps u=(1,1) and d=(1,-1); a double rise in a Grand Dyck path is an occurrence of uu in the path.) +0
2
2, 5, 1, 14, 5, 1, 42, 19, 8, 1, 132, 67, 40, 12, 1, 429, 232, 166, 79, 17, 1, 1430, 804, 634, 395, 145, 23, 1, 4862, 2806, 2335, 1708, 879, 249, 30, 1, 16796, 9878, 8480, 6824, 4376, 1823, 404, 38, 1, 58786, 35072, 30691, 26137, 19334, 10521, 3542, 625, 47, 1 (list; graph; listen)
